Kimberly Bloomquist

December 17, 1962 — March 27, 2020

Kimberly A. Bloomquist, 57, of Otho, passed away on Friday, March 27th, 2020. A Celebration of Life will be 4:00 to 7:00 PM Friday, June 12, 2020 at the funeral home. Private family burial will be Saturday, June 13, 2020. Survivors include daughter Abbigail Bloomquist of Creston, son Alex (Hope) Bloomquist of Thor, father Richard "Sam" Rathbun (Kay Read) of Otho, sister Deb (Gary) Fox of Otho, niece April (Shane) Essam and family, nephews Luke (Baileigh) Ashbrook and family, Landon Ashbrook, and Nick (Pam) Fox and family. She was preceded in death by her mother Marilyn Rathbun and her brother Rod Rathbun. Kimberly Ann Bloomquist was born on December 17, 1962 in Fort Dodge. She attended schools here and graduated from Fort Dodge Senior High School in 1981. Following her education, she worked at The Colonial Inn. In 1985, she was united in marriage to Terry Blomquist and the couple made their home east of Fort Dodge. The couple were later divorced. Kim worked at the Otho Pub and when her children were born she also ran a day care. She later was employed with Younkers and Kid Zone Daycare Center at First Presbyterian Church. Kim moved to Minneapolis, MN, where she graduated from Dakota County Technical College with a degree in Professional Gardening. Kim returned to Fort Dodge where she worked at Menards and then was the manager of Earl May Garden Center. She had a green thumb and enjoyed gardening. Kim was an animal lover, volunteered at Blanden Museum for several years and was also very active in helping with youth group at St. Mark's Episcopal Church. Kim enjoyed camping with her family and being an active community supporter. Kim will be missed by all who knew her. Memorials may be left to the discretion of the family.
